一、為什麼需要升級MySQL?
MySQL作為目前最流行的開源資料庫之一,其版本的升級是基本操作。不同的版本有不同的優化及改進,這些改進可以顯著提高MySQL的性能。同時,隨著時間的推移,舊版本可能出現Bug或者安全漏洞,需要及時升級。
因此,升級MySQL不僅可以改進性能,還可以保證資料庫的安全可靠性。
二、升級MySQL前的準備工作
1、備份數據:在升級MySQL之前,首先需要備份當前資料庫的數據以備不測。
2、準備升級包:下載最新版的MySQL升級包,確保升級包完整且無損壞。
3、了解操作系統的版本及位數:MySQL升級需要根據操作系統位數下載相應的安裝包,比如32位的操作系統需要下載32位的MySQL安裝包。
三、升級MySQL
1、使用root許可權登錄MySQL資料庫,輸入如下命令查看當前版本:
mysql -u root -p SHOW VARIABLES LIKE 'version%';
2、停止MySQL Server進程,輸入如下命令:
sudo service mysql stop
3、移除當前版本的MySQL:
sudo apt-get --purge remove mysql-server mysql-client mysql-common
如果當前使用的是MySQL 5.7及以上版本,則需要先卸載mysql-apt-config包:
sudo apt-get --purge remove mysql-apt-config
4、安裝新版本的MySQL:
導入MySQL的APT GPG key:
sudo apt-key adv --keyserver keys.gnupg.net --recv-keys 5072E1F5
添加MySQL APT repository:
echo "deb http://repo.mysql.com/apt/ubuntu/ $(lsb_release -cs) mysql-5.7" | sudo tee /etc/apt/sources.list.d/mysql.list
更新APT cache:
sudo apt-get update
安裝MySQL 5.7:
sudo apt-get install mysql-server
5、啟動MySQL Server進程,輸入如下命令:
sudo service mysql start
四、注意事項
1、升級之前一定要備份數據,避免數據丟失。
2、在升級過程中要按照順序操作,否則可能會出現問題。
3、在升級過程中要根據操作系統位數選擇相應的MySQL安裝包。
4、如果當前使用的是MySQL 5.7及以上版本,則需要先卸載mysql-apt-config包。
五、總結
升級MySQL是提高其性能及安全可靠性的必要手段。在升級前要備份數據,並且要按照順序進行操作。在升級過程中需要注意選擇正確的MySQL安裝包並且遵循操作步驟,可以保證升級的成功。
原創文章,作者:TKME,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/145032.html